Title:
CYANURIC ACID DERIVATIVE AND METHOD FOR DETECTING MELAMINE USING SAME
Document Type and Number:
WIPO Patent Application WO/2012/029955
Kind Code:
A1
Abstract:
[Problem] To provide a method for simply and quickly detecting melamine with high sensitivity, and a fluorescent compound necessary for detection. [Solution] The cyanuric acid derivative represented by general formula (1) (wherein: A represents an n-valent residue excluding n hydrogen atoms from a conjugated compound A'; B either represents a single bond, or represents an alkylene group with 1 to 9 carbon atoms, which may be broken up by 1 to 3 oxygen atoms (the alkylene group may be substituted with a halogen atom or a substituent of no more than 7 carbon atoms); and n is a positive integer that satisfies 2 ≤ n ≤ 8), and a method for detecting melamine characterized by using the cyanuric acid derivative.
